Planning appeal decision

Notice varied and upheld22 May 20263344671

53 Albion Street, Broadstairs, Kent, CT10 1NE

Without planning permission, alterations to the existing front elevation consisting of the replacement of the timber ground floor bay with aluminium windows and doors and the installation of spotlighting

Authority
Thanet District Council
Appeal type
enforcement · Enforcement Notice
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
other · Householder developments
Inspector
Goldberg V

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• the effect of the development on the character and appearance of the conservation area
  • the effect of the development on the significance of the non-designated heritage asset (NDHA) known as The Dolphin Public House, 55 Albion Street

What decided it

The development fails to preserve or enhance the character and appearance of the conservation area and negatively affects the significance of the adjacent non-designated heritage asset through its contemporary design and materials, which are incongruous with the traditional historic context.

Framework references: 212, 215

Plan policies cited: SP36, HE02, HE03, BSP9
